## Approvals: Autocomplete Index Rebuild

The Quillhart search autocomplete index is slow to rebuild after schema changes. Any change touching the suggester pipeline needs sign-off before merge. No exceptions, even for hotfixes. Rebuilds block staging for up to two hours, so batch your changes. New team members: read the indexer runbook first. All approvals go through one person.

named custodian: Brivan Eliath Quenox Frador

Off-site Run Checklist — Sample Shipment to Corvane Labs

[ ] Samples boxed, cold packs checked, seals numbered.
[ ] Manifest printed in duplicate; one copy inside the box.
[ ] Courier: Redfern Express, morning slot only.
[ ] Log departure time at the desk.
[ ] No hand-over without the manifest countersigned. Confidential hand-over instruction for the driver:

courier memo of fajeg-yahif: the ulaael belath courier leaves the zoriel novwyn pelys ledger at gate 1311 under passcode 386270

Minutes — Management Meeting, Quillon Instruments. Present: A. Renvik, O. Dastry, F. Lomb. Topic: currency hedging. Exposure to the Ardalian market now exceeds tolerance. Decision: hedge 60% of forecast Ardalian receivables via forwards, six-month rolling. F. Lomb owns execution. Sales leads: quote in local currency only with the new rate card; no discretionary FX adjustments. Review at next quarterly meeting. Rationale and next steps are outlined in the confidential note below.

internal memo for fawef-tajeg: Headcount on the Wenvan team goes from 33 to 121 by the end of January. Gross margin on Wenvan came in at 47 percent against a plan of 51 percent.

Facilities Ticket — Cleaning Crew Access, Brindle Annex

For new starters handling evening lock-up: the Sorano Cleaning crew arrives nightly at 21:30 via the annex side door. Check their rota sheet, note arrival in the log, and ensure the storeroom is relocked afterward. To let them through the side door, enter the access code below.

badge for yaweg-hafog: bdg-GX-6